Something interesting new today from the wikileaks' cables:

"U.S. drugmaker Pfizer hired investigators to find evidence of corruption against Nigeria's attorney general to convince him to drop legal action against the company over a drug trial involving children

Nigeria's Kano state sued the world's largest drugmaker in May 2007 for $2 billion over testing of the meningitis drug Trovan. State authorities said the tests killed 11 children and left dozens disabled.

Pfizer and Kano's state government signed a $75 million settlement on July 30."

I can't find any major media outlet reporting on this yet, but there's another interesting cable that's starting to get some news. I'll try to summarize it:

The story of Khalid El-Masri is fairly well-known. He was a German civilian with an unfortunate name (Khalid Al-Masri is an Al Qaeda agent with ties to the 9/11 attack) who was vacationing in Macedonia when he was kidnapped by CIA agents, who rendition'd his ass over to a secret prison in Afghanistan, where he was held for roughly 6 months.

During his capture and imprisonment, he was repeatedly beaten, drugged, "interrogated", and even at one point sodomized. He was also subject to some kind of bizarre starvation regimen. This has all been verified through both official and independent investigation. Over weeks of interrogation and verifying this man's identity, eventually the CIA officials at the "salt pit", the secret prison where he was being held, realized he actually was innocent and who he said he was, but they decided not to release him anyways because he knew too much. He was finally released after a direct order from Condoleeza Rice.

Germany declined to take any kind of action against the US for this torture and extraordinary rendition of their own citizen, and all calls to judicial review in the US has been quashed. Arrest warrants for the CIA agents involved were eventually issued by the Audencia Nacional of Spain. All of that is history. But what is new is that, according to this cable, directed to Rice, Germany's lack of action stemmed from a meeting held between the German deputy national security advisor, Rolf Nikel, and a US diplomat, who urged "that the German Government weigh carefully at every step of the way the implications for relations with the U.S." Well, one need only apply a bit of imagination from there.
